Tri-Tip Cooking Instructions
Ingredients:
1 Package My Family Seasoning 1 3-5 Pound Tri-Tip 1 Tablespoon Oil

Directions:
-
POUR seasoning in small bowl and stir well. Surround entire tri-tip with seasoning. If possible, marinate in refrigerator over night.
-
On a charcoal grill, wait until the coals are ash-covered and the heat medium. On a gas bar-b-que, bring to med. heat
-
Using tongs and a paper towel to wipe a thin sheen of oil on the grill grate. Place Tri- Tip on grill over direct heat. You should hear a slight sizzle, but the heat should not be too high. Grill uncovered, turning several times for 35 to 45 mins.
TEST FOR DONENESS:
The easiest way is by simply cutting off a small piece of the triangular ends. When the center is an opaque pink (medium rare) the rest of the tri-tip has about five minutes to cook. Eat this corner yourself; it's the cook's sample!
OR . . . check meat as it cooks with an instant read thermometer. For medium rare remove from grill when temperature reaches 140 degrees
Let meat r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ing. This allows the juices to seep in and flavors to continue to blend. It also keeps the meat juicy!
Slice the meat with a sharp carving knife against the grain, in the thinnest cuts you can manage.
TIPS:
If while carving you discover that the inside of the tri-tip is raw or too rare for your taste, return it to the grill at low heat until it reaches desired doneness.
